孔底起爆技术在漂塘钨矿区的应用

摘    要:分析了漂塘钨矿区原中深孔爆破长期采用孔口起爆方法所存在的问题,根据孔底起爆在上向扇形中深孔爆破中能降低大块产出的破碎机理,以及针对漂塘矿区的地质条件和采矿方法现状,进行了孔底起爆的中深孔爆破设计。文章介绍了孔底起爆的具体操作方法和应用成果。通过91次井下大爆破的实践,取得主要技术经济指标:炸药单耗0.47 kg/t,导爆索单耗0.02 m/t,导爆管毫秒雷管单耗0.05发/t,每米崩矿量4.62 t。该技术的应用4年来为企业创造了162.7万元以上的直接经济效益。

Application of Hole Bottom Detonation Technology in Piaotang Tungsten Mining Region

Abstract:Problems of hole-bottom detonation technology at Piaotang Tungsten Mining Region were analyzed. Mid and deep blasting was designed according to the blasting mechanism, geological conditions and current mining technology. This paper introduces the operation methods and application results of hole-bottom detonation technology. Some major economic indexes were obtained by 91 underground blasting experiments, including explosives consumption (0.47 kg/t), detonating cord consumption (0.02 m/t), nonel millisecond detonator consumption(0.05/t), collapsed ore per meter(4.62 t). The direct economic benefit of this technology in the past 4 years reaches 1.6 million RMB.
